若干个Java基础面试题


Posted in 面试题 onMay 19, 2015
1. 一下a,b两段代码那个执行速度更快?
a. for(int i = 100000; i>0; i–){}
b. for (int i = 1; i 2. 一下两段代码那个执行速度更快?
a. Math.max(a,b);
b.(a>b)?a:b
3. Array操作是不是比Vector更快?
4. 如果Point p的如下方法被调用之前是(700, 800), 那么当如下a,b方法执行后,Point p的值分别为多少?
a. static void changePoint ( Point p) {
p.x = 100; p.y=200;
}

b. static void changePoint(Point p) {
p=new Point(100,200);
}
5. MyClass.java和空文件是合法的java源文件,这个说法正确吗?
6. 下面哪种说法正确?

Char \u0061r a =’a’;
Char \u0062 = ’b’;
Char c =’\u0063’;



1 b. 2 c.3 d. ALL e. NONE
答案:
1.答案:a
2.答案: b
3.是的,Array更快
4.答案:a. (100,200) b. (700,800) 基本类型在方法参数中是按值传递的,而对象是按引用的值传递的,在一个方法内如果对象的值改变了,会有影响。但是如果我们改变引用本身,它的原始引用/对象不会改变,只有引用的拷贝会改变。
5.答案:是的
6.答案:d

Tags in this post...

面试题 相关文章推荐
如何设定的weblogic的热启动模式(开发模式)与产品发布模式
Sep 08 面试题
AOP的定义以及作用
Sep 08 面试题
输入N,打印N*N矩阵
Feb 20 面试题
SQL数据库笔试题
Mar 08 面试题
一套.net面试题及答案
Nov 02 面试题
C#笔试题
Jul 14 面试题
C#的几个面试问题
May 22 面试题
软件缺陷的分类都有哪些
Aug 22 面试题
EJB3推出JPA的原因
Oct 16 面试题
Python如何实现单例模式
Jun 03 面试题
若通过ObjectOutputStream向一个文件中多次以追加方式写入object,为什么用ObjectInputStream读取这些object时会产生StreamCorruptedException?
Oct 17 面试题
Java语言程序设计测试题选择题部分
Apr 03 面试题
JAVA高级程序员面试题
Sep 06 #面试题
静态变量和实例变量的区别
Jul 07 #面试题
代码中finally中的代码会不会执行
Feb 06 #面试题
怎样声明一个匿名的内部类
Jun 01 #面试题
中科前程Java笔试题
Nov 20 #面试题
JAVA程序设计笔试题面试题一套
Jul 28 #面试题
内部类的定义、种类以及优点
Oct 16 #面试题
You might like
实用函数10
2007/11/08 PHP
php cookie 作用范围?不要在当前页面使用你的cookie
2009/03/24 PHP
php清除和销毁session的方法分析
2015/03/19 PHP
thinkPHP简单实现多个子查询语句的方法
2016/12/05 PHP
PHP面向对象学习之parent::关键字
2017/01/18 PHP
{}与function(){}选用空对象{}来存放keyValue
2012/05/23 Javascript
使用jquery实现图文切换效果另加特效
2013/01/20 Javascript
Jquery实现带动画效果的经典二级导航菜单
2013/03/22 Javascript
JavaScript子类用Object.getPrototypeOf去调用父类方法解析
2013/12/05 Javascript
js操作滚动条事件实例
2015/01/29 Javascript
js实现鼠标悬停图片上时滚动文字说明的方法
2015/02/17 Javascript
JavaScript实现MIPS乘法模拟的方法
2015/04/17 Javascript
javascript使用 concat 方法对数组进行合并的方法
2016/09/08 Javascript
vue组件间通信解析
2017/03/01 Javascript
Agularjs妙用双向数据绑定实现手风琴效果
2017/05/26 Javascript
解决vue-cli创建项目的loader问题
2018/03/13 Javascript
详解一个基于react+webpack的多页面应用配置
2019/01/21 Javascript
基于Proxy的小程序状态管理实现
2019/06/14 Javascript
Vue记住滚动条和实现下拉加载的完美方法
2020/07/31 Javascript
解决removeEventListener 无法清除监听的问题
2020/10/30 Javascript
[55:35]DOTA2-DPC中国联赛 正赛 CDEC vs Dragon BO3 第二场 1月22日
2021/03/11 DOTA
python实现汉诺塔方法汇总
2016/07/25 Python
Django中的文件的上传的几种方式
2018/07/23 Python
django admin组件使用方法详解
2019/07/19 Python
python GUI库图形界面开发之PyQt5 Qt Designer工具(Qt设计师)详细使用方法及Designer ui文件转py文件方法
2020/02/26 Python
不到20行实现Python代码即可制作精美证件照
2020/04/24 Python
python入门教程之基本算术运算符
2020/11/13 Python
python爬虫快速响应服务器的做法
2020/11/24 Python
详解Python中openpyxl模块基本用法
2021/02/23 Python
《雷鸣电闪波尔卡》教学反思
2014/02/23 职场文书
中学生英语演讲稿
2014/04/26 职场文书
机关党建工作汇报材料
2014/08/20 职场文书
浅谈如何提高PHP代码的质量
2021/05/28 PHP
苹果M1芯片安装nginx 并且部署vue项目步骤详解
2021/11/20 Servers
Python matplotlib多个子图绘制整合
2022/04/13 Python
Go语言测试库testify使用学习
2022/07/23 Golang